In mammals, COP1, an E3 ubiquitin ligase, is involved in the regulation of diverse cellular processes, such as cell growth, differentiation, and survival. COP1's versatility in certain conditions, such as amplified expression or diminished function, allows it to act either as an oncogenic protein or a tumor suppressor, accomplishing this effect through the ubiquitination-mediated degradation of proteins. Selleck Ceftaroline Nevertheless, the specific contribution of COP1 in primary articular chondrocytes is not fully understood. Our study focused on the effect of COP1 on the transformation of chondrocytes in the context of their differentiation. COP1 overexpression, scrutinized via reverse transcription-polymerase chain reaction and Western blotting, resulted in decreased type II collagen production, augmented cyclooxygenase 2 (COX-2) expression, and decreased sulfated proteoglycan production, as revealed by Alcian blue staining analysis. Upon siRNA administration, type II collagen was revived, alongside an elevation in sulfated proteoglycan production and a decrease in COX-2 expression levels. Following cDNA and siRNA transfection into chondrocytes, the COP1 protein exhibited control over the phosphorylation states of p38 kinase and ERK-1/-2 signaling pathways. In transfected chondrocytes, the expression of type II collagen and COX-2 was decreased when the p38 kinase and ERK-1/-2 signaling pathways were blocked by SB203580 and PD98059, indicating a regulatory role of COP1 in chondrocyte differentiation and inflammation within the rabbit articular system via the p38 kinase and ERK-1/-2 signaling cascade.

Multidisciplinary, systematic evaluations, while improving outcomes in difficult-to-treat asthma, fail to identify clear response indicators. By employing a treatable-traits framework, we sorted patients according to their trait profiles, systematically assessing their clinical effects and sensitivity to treatment.
During systematic assessments at our institution, 12 traits were used in latent class analysis for patients with difficult-to-treat asthma. Our study included a detailed analysis of Asthma Control Questionnaire (ACQ-6) and Asthma Quality of Life Questionnaire (AQLQ) scores, as well as the FEV.
Exacerbation frequency and the maintenance oral corticosteroid (mOCS) dose were measured at the initial stage and after a comprehensive assessment.
Within a cohort of 241 patients, two airway-centric profiles were identified. The first involved early-onset allergic rhinitis (n=46), while the second comprised adult-onset eosinophilia/chronic rhinosinusitis (n=60). These profiles demonstrated minimal comorbid or psychosocial characteristics. Conversely, three non-airway-centric profiles were observed: one dominated by comorbid conditions (obesity, vocal cord dysfunction, dysfunctional breathing; n=51), another focused on psychosocial issues (anxiety, depression, smoking, unemployment; n=72), and the final one characterized by multiple domain impairments (n=12). Selleck Ceftaroline Baseline ACQ-6 scores were significantly lower in airway-centric profiles (22) than in non-airway-centric profiles (27), a difference statistically significant (p<.001). Similarly, AQLQ scores were higher in airway-centric profiles (45) than in non-airway-centric profiles (38), also demonstrating a statistically significant difference (p<.001). Systematic evaluation of the cohort indicated a positive trend in all areas. Nevertheless, profiles focused on the airways exhibited higher FEV values.
A positive result emerged for airway-centric profiles with a substantial improvement (56% versus 22% predicted, p<.05), whereas non-airway-centric profiles showed a possible reduction in exacerbation (17 versus 10, p=.07); the mOCS dose reduction exhibited no statistically significant difference (31mg versus 35mg, p=.782).
The diverse clinical outcomes and treatment responsiveness seen in difficult-to-treat asthma are linked to distinct trait profiles identified via systematic assessment. This research delves into a nonlinear age-structured population model, focusing on discontinuous mortality and fertility rates. Differences in maturation periods are thought to be responsible for substantial rate variations. On a custom mesh, we develop a novel numerical method that integrates two-layer boundary conditions with linearly implicit methods. A uniform boundedness analysis of numerical solutions, in conjunction with the fundamental approach for smooth rates, enables the demonstration of piecewise finite-time convergence. In juvenile-adult models, the presence of a numerical endemic equilibrium is predicated on a numerical basic reproduction function's convergence to the precise value, achieving first-order accuracy. It is numerically observed that the disease-free equilibrium exhibits approximate global stability, and the endemic equilibrium shows approximate local stability in juvenile-adult models. To conclude, numerical experiments involving Logistic models and tadpoles-frogs models offer empirical validation and highlight the effectiveness of our outcomes.

The study sought to determine the differential impact of endurance training tailored to individual responses, as measured by objective heart rate variability (HRV) or self-reported stress (DALDA questionnaire), versus a standardized training regimen, on enhancing endurance performance in recreational runners. Thirty-six male recreational runners were divided into three groups after a two-week baseline period, during which resting heart rate variability and self-reported stress were measured: HRV-guided (GHRV; n=12), DALDA-guided (GD; n=12), and predefined training (GT; n=12) group. Subjects engaged in 5 weeks of endurance training, subsequent to which they underwent testing for track and field peak velocity (Vpeak TF), time limit (Tlim) at 100% of Vpeak TF, and a 5km time trial (5km TT). The application of GD yielded more significant enhancements in Vpeak TF (8418%; ES=141) and 5km TT (-12842%; ES=-197) compared to GHRV (6615% and -8328%; ES=-120; 124) and GT (4915% and -6033%; ES=-082; 068), respectively, without impacting Tlim. Self-reported stress measures can be instrumental in personalizing daily endurance training, potentially contributing to enhanced performance. The addition of heart rate variability data provides a more comprehensive picture of the physiological responses to daily training.
